WebThe Forensic Capability Network is the new organisation for forensic science in England and Wales. Our mission is to run the world’s most advanced and coordinated forensics … WebApr 8, 2024 · Called Forensic Capability Network (FCN), the network supports more than 4,000 forensic science specialists with critical technology, advice and services. WebAug 3, 2016 · Forensic Readiness could help an organization to simplify its activities of the digital investigation after a data breach so that retrieval of digital evidence becomes easy with reduced issues. Furthermore, digital evidence is appropriately acquired and stored even before an incident occurs, without interruption of operations.
